在以太坊网络中,签名是用户发起转账的必要步骤。签名过程确保了交易的有效性和安全性,只有具有私钥的用户才能对其账户进行操作。当用户试图在其以太坊钱包中发送交易时,钱包需要使用私钥对交易进行签名。如果过程中出现任何问题,比如私钥不正确或交易数据损坏,就会引发签名错误。
签名错误通常是由于技术或操作失误引起的。当用户发现转账时出现签名错误,往往意味着交易未能成功进行,资金仍停留在原钱包地址上。
影响以太坊转账签名的因素有很多,以下是一些常见原因:
面对以太坊钱包中的签名错误,用户可以采取以下几种方法进行解决:
预防以太坊钱包转账中的签名错误,用户可以从以下几个方面入手:
如果你的以太坊钱包频繁提示签名错误,可能由多种因素引起。首要原因可能是你所使用的私钥无效。建议再次确认你输入的私钥是否正确,确保其与钱包地址匹配。其次,如果你的钱包应用版本较旧,可能会有未修复的Bug,建议及时更新。同时,你的网络连接状态也可能影响签名生成,因此可以尝试重启路由器或换用其他网络。
最后,某些特殊情况下,交易数据在生成过程中也可能出现错误,比如错误的接收地址或不合理的手续费设置等。务必确保所有填写的信息都无误。如果以上方法均无效,考虑重新下载和安装钱包应用,或更换其他品牌的钱包进行尝试。
生成正确的签名是以太坊转账成功的关键。首先,确保你所使用的钱包软件具备生成签名的功能,通常主流钱包如MetaMask, MyEtherWallet等都提供了这一功能。在进行转账时,钱包软件会自动将交易信息(包括发送方地址、接收方地址、转账金额及手续费等)与私钥结合进行加密,以生成唯一的签名。
在输入地址和金额时,请遵循操作界面的准确提示,确保无误。同时,也可以在确认转账前找一位信任的朋友进行复核,确保信息的准确性。一般来说,正规钱包会自动为用户生成签名,用户只需要确认交易详细信息并签名确认。
一旦以太坊交易因签名错误而失败,这笔交易并不会在区块链上记录,而是会停留在交易池中进行重试。用户可以查看钱包的转账记录,确认交易状态。如果未成功,那么可以重新发起交易,确保新交易中使用的私钥和清晰的交易信息,避免相同错误的再次发生。
在一些情况下,如果你已经在以太坊网络上进行了多次交易,而其中某个交易因签名错误未能进行,那么你可以选择支付更高的手续费来加速已有交易的处理,这在技术上被称为“交易冲突”机制。需要注意的是,并非所有钱包都支持这种操作,因此最好对钱包的功能有深入了解。
签名是以太坊转账过程中验证身份与交易真实性的关键。以太坊使用椭圆曲线数字签名算法(ECDSA)来确保签名的安全性和唯一性。用户的钱包应用会将交易信息与私钥结合生成数字签名,这一过程如下:
1. 钱包应用生成交易对象,包括所有必要的交易信息。
2. 用户通过私钥生成该交易对象的哈希值。 3. 该哈希值通过ECDSA算法与私钥计算生成唯一的数字签名。因此,私钥的安全性决定了签名的安全性,用户务必保护好自己的私钥,避免被黑客截获或泄露,一旦私钥泄露,所有相关资产都将处于危险之中。
以太坊钱包除了转账功能外,还有多种其它实用功能,包括:
总结而言,以太坊钱包转账中出现的签名错误不仅给用户带来了困扰,也提醒我们在进行数字货币操作时应当保持高度的谨慎。通过了解签名错误的原因及解决方法,以及如何预防错误的发生,相信用户能够更好地利用以太坊钱包进行安全便捷的数字资产管理。